Why Clients Depart : Straightforward SEO Sales Advice

It’s a tough reality: customers *do* leave. And often, it's not about your technical skills; you might be an amazing SEO expert. The problem frequently stems from misaligned expectations regarding results, communication breakdowns, or a feeling of shortage of value. Some feel they're not seeing enough improvement in their rankings or traffic; others experience frustration with your reporting format. Perhaps you over-promised initially and now are struggling to provide on those promises. Finally, a common reason is an inability to adapt to changing business needs -- they've outgrown your services consultative sales SEO or moved in a different direction, which isn’t necessarily a reflection of your work, but simply a consequence of their own evolution.

Search Engine Optimization Sales Mistakes That Cost You Clients

Many firms making the push for increased online visibility through search engine optimization unknowingly commit sales blunders that ultimately alienate potential customers . Focusing solely on search results without discussing specific needs can feel like pushing a product nobody wants. Similarly, over-promising results —such as guaranteed page one visibility within a limited duration—sets unrealistic expectations and leads to disappointed users. Failing to clearly explain the approach, the required effort, or providing transparent pricing structures creates distrust and often results in lost contracts. Finally, neglecting to follow up consistently after the initial consultation or proposal leaves a poor impression and can hand leads directly to your adversaries.

Losing Clients Over SEO? The Brutal Truth

It's a harsh reality: many businesses are seeing a decline in clients due to perceived failings in their Search Engine Optimization (SEO) efforts. This isn’t always about bad rankings; often, it's about a lack of clarity surrounding the process itself and unmet goals. Clients might feel they aren’t getting value for their investment, leading to frustration and ultimately, a cancellation of services. The situation is frequently exacerbated by a lack of open communication from the SEO agency or consultant—clients want to understand *what* you're doing and *why*, not just be presented with rankings. Here’s what often fuels this issue:

  • Inflated promises regarding ranking timelines.
  • A failure to educate clients about the complexities of SEO.
  • Variable performance, even when due to factors beyond your control.
  • Meager communication and reporting on progress.
  • A shift in client business needs that SEO isn’t directly addressing.

Addressing this requires a strategic approach: managing expectations upfront, maintaining constant dialogue, and delivering clear, useful data—even when the news isn't entirely positive. Ignoring these points can lead to a downward spiral of lost clients and a damaged standing within the industry.

Avoid Alienating Customers : SEO’s Biggest Negatives

It's crucial to remember that effective SEO isn't just about ranking high; it's also about providing a great user experience. Many common SEO techniques, while perhaps boosting search engine visibility, can actually push away potential customers. Think keyword stuffing—it makes content difficult to read and frustrating for visitors. Similarly, excessive ad placements or a slow-loading website will quickly send people searching elsewhere . Ignoring mobile optimization is another significant problem , as a huge portion of web traffic comes from smartphones and tablets. Finally, deceptive link building practices – attempting to game the system instead of earning trust - can seriously damage your reputation and result in penalties that negatively impact your rankings long term, ultimately costing you valuable business.
